This is the 2nd Mei Tai (baby carrier) I have made. I think I am actually going to look for a pattern just cause I think there might be a better way to assemble. I tried different machine quilting on this one. I actually did circles!! Oh well, I wasn't really happy with it, but the friend I am making it for will love it no matter what. I actually made her a quilt earlier (2nd picture in link below) and found the same fabric so I could make them coordinating!
